Film Premiere Highlights Blockchain and Media Convergence
TOKEN2049 Dubai recently hosted the premiere of the blockchain film “Decentralized no Matter What V.4”, highlighting the intersection of blockchain and media. The event aimed to showcase innovative film funding through decentralized models. Token2049 Dubai Event Information
The event attracted significant figures such as Changpeng Zhao from Binance and Arthur Hayes from Maelstrom. It emphasized NFTs and DAOs, engaging communities through blockchain technology. This gathering illustrates Dubai’s broader role in the crypto sector, as noted by Raoul Pal, Co-Founder/CEO of Real Vision:
“TOKEN2049 is truly a landmark gathering for the crypto community, reflecting the rapid evolution of our industry and the innovative collaboration that is taking place.”
